- Incidents | CAL FIRE
Fires occur throughout the State within CAL FIRE jurisdiction on a daily basis during fire season However, the majority of those fires are contained quickly and no information will generally be provided on these incidents at this site if the fire burns less than 10 acres

- California fires updates: Death toll in Los Angeles fires rises to 29
At least 29 people have died as multiple wildfires, fueled by severe drought conditions and strong winds, rage across Southern California Thousands of firefighters have been battling wildfires across 45 square miles of densely populated Los Angeles County
